duskly wrote: Thu Apr 17, 2025 9:52 am Alright, I'm sold. Gonna try the beef heart mix. Any tips on how to get them to eat it at first? My Discus can be picky. Tank's got a bunch of neon tetras and some otos. Water changes are 30% weekly, temp at 84°F. The filter's a hang-on-back, and I've got some dwarf hairgrass in there.
Starve 'em for a day, then offer it. They'll go nuts. My Discus were sketchy at first too, but now they swarm the second they see the tweezers. Tank's got some cherry barbs and a pair of rams. Water changes are 50% every 4 days, temp at 86°F. It's all about patience.

Yep, starving them for a bit works. Also, try soaking the food in garlic guard. It's like crack for Discus. My tank's got some apistos and a bunch of ember tetras. Water changes are 50% weekly, temp at 85°F. The beef heart mix is a bit messy, so be ready to siphon out the leftovers if they don't eat it all.
